Atomic Number 13 (Part 2)

Nov 05, 2022 - Nov 19, 2022

Vertical Gallery is very proud to present 鈥楢tomic Number 13 part 2,鈥 a group show featuring new work from a local, national, and international roster of artists, curated by Chicago-based art services and custom framing company ArtBuilds. After the incredible success of 'Atomic Number 13' in December 2021, Vertical and ArtBuilds immediately decided to partner again for part 2.

The title 鈥楢tomic Number 13鈥 honors aluminum鈥檚 spot on the periodic table of elements. Renda began painting on aluminum composite panels five years ago, inspired by his mentor Anthony Adcock, an instructor at the American Academy of Art. 鈥淥nce I realized I could make these panels whatever size I wanted, or build them in different shapes, I was hooked, and I stopped painting on canvas and wood,鈥 Renda says. 鈥淭hese panels are the smoothest, most archival surface you can paint on, and unlike other surfaces, they don鈥檛 absorb moisture, so they鈥檙e not going to warp over time.鈥

Renda launched ArtBuilds in 2018 to provide much-needed framing and construction services to his peers in the artist community. 鈥淚 make everything by hand, all from natural wood 鈥 not just frames, but also custom canvases, shipping crates and pedestals. Artists make up 90 percent of my clientele, and the other 10 percent are galleries and collectors.鈥 ArtBuilds has been working with Vertical since before Renda officially founded the company: when the gallery needed assistance with multiple projects, Renda offered his support, and the partnership continues to this day.

鈥淏eyond showing the versatility of the aluminum panels, I wanted to show the diversity of art out there,鈥 he explains. 鈥淲ith so many artists working in so many different styles, everyone who attends this show is going to discover something that they love.鈥
